Millennium Fellowship Project: Green Plate Movement
Imagine all shops, restaurants despite of using single use disposable plastic using natural alternatives like Sal leaf plates, Bagasse plates and rice straws etc. This will significantly decrease the load on the environment that is being created due to excessive use of single use plastics. My aim is to promote these innovations for fostering the environmental good as well a providing employment in the rural areas for their
production in SMEs and cost effective solution for the merchants, thus creating a win-win environment. Making it compulsory in our campus is the aim of this initiative. It is under the UN SDG 12 Responsible Consumption and Production.
